Delegates at this year’s EAIC conference in Taiwan are apparently undecided on whether cedants in the region will cut their reinsurance panels in the 2015 renewals, according to a poll conducted by PartnerRe from its booth at the event.
According to PartnerRe's market poll at the EAIC, some 50 percent of delegates think that insurers in Asia Pacific are likely to reduce the number of reinsurers on their panels at the upcoming renewals, while the other 50 percent said they thought there would be no reduction.
"It seems delegates say they want to keep relationships with as many reinsurers as possible," said a representative from PartnerRe.
